Stores Co-Ordinator
Lancaster Full-time £30,000 + Benefits
Days – Monday-Friday
We re looking for a driven and organised Stores Co-Ordinator to take ownership of engineering stores across two busy manufacturing sites. This is a brand-new role, created to bring structure, organisation, and efficiency to the stores function.
What You ll Be Doing
-
Taking charge of engineering stores across both the paper mill and converting site
-
Implementing structure and organisation, ensuring storage areas and cupboards are well maintained
-
Using SAP (purchasing) and Shire CMMS to manage and control stock
-
Reviewing and refreshing suppliers, negotiating better deals where possible
-
Introducing improvements such as min/max stock levels and supplier management
-
Driving a proactive, rather than reactive, stores function
What We re Looking For
-
Experience in stores management, ideally within a manufacturing environment
-
A hands-on, proactive approach with excellent organisational skills
-
Strong communication and influencing skills, with the ability to build relationships across teams
-
Confidence in negotiating with suppliers
-
Health & Safety awareness and a good understanding of 5S principles
What s On Offer
-
Salary: £30,000 per year
-
Hours: Monday to Friday, 8:00am 4:30pm (30-min lunch)
-
Benefits: Pension, 25 days holiday, employee discounts, and salary sacrifice schemes
-
A one-stage interview including a site tour
This role is ideal for someone who thrives on bringing order to chaos, enjoys working with people, and is motivated by making a visible impact on site performance.
